Five years is wood, and it is the first milestone on the list that most people actually mark properly. A 5th anniversary gift tends to get more thought than the second or the third, partly because five is a round number and partly because wood is the first material on the traditional list that suggests something built rather than something bought.

Why Wood Is the Right Symbol for Five

The first four years are paper, cotton, leather and fruit. All of them are soft, and three of the four are gone within a season. Wood is the point where the list changes its mind: something with rings in it, that took years to make, that gets harder rather than softer with age. Five years is where a marriage stops being new and starts having a grain.

Which is why the literal reading, a wooden bowl or a carved keepsake, usually undersells it. Wood is more useful as a subject than as a substrate: warm palettes, botanical forms, tree and branch imagery, anything that carries growth and time without needing a caption to explain the connection.

The Rule Behind Every Anniversary Design Here

The milestone number lives in the title and in the search, never printed into the artwork. A piece that says "5 Years" across the middle is right for twelve months and then permanently slightly wrong, and it comes off the wall long before the marriage does. A wood or botanical subject carries the fifth year through what the picture is about, so the piece is bought for the fifth and is still hanging correctly on the twelfth.

Where a design carries names and a date, they belong inside the composition rather than underneath it. Cover the lettering with your thumb: if what is left is still art you would hang, the personal detail decorated something real. A date is permanently true; a milestone number is not.

Choosing a Size and a Frame

Fifth-anniversary pieces usually go in a bedroom or a living room. Above a bed or a sofa, take roughly two thirds of the furniture width, which lands at 18x24" or 24x36" in most rooms and 28x40" on a wide wall. In a hallway or beside a bedside table, 11x14" and 16x20" are the working sizes and keep any lettering readable up close. The 5x7" framed print is the entry size and is small enough to hand over in person.

Frames come in black, white, natural wood and dark wood. Natural wood is the obvious partner for the wood milestone and the safest choice for a room you have not seen.

5th Anniversary Questions

What is the traditional 5th anniversary gift?

Wood. It is the first material on the list that implies something built and lasting rather than something soft, which is why the fifth tends to get marked more carefully than the years before it.

Does it have to be made of wood?

No, and taking it literally is usually the weaker option. Using wood as a subject, through warm palettes, botanical forms or tree imagery, gives you something that lives on a wall rather than another object competing for a shelf.

Should the artwork say "5 Years"?

Better not. A number in the picture sets an expiry date on it. Keep the number in the card and in how you give it, and let the artwork carry the year through its subject.

What size should I choose?

18x24" or 24x36" above a bed or a sofa, 11x14" or 16x20" for a hallway or a bedside wall. For a room you have not seen, 16x20" in a natural wood frame is the lowest-risk combination.
